Blood and urine lab testing can gauge how well bioidentical hormone replacement therapy (BHRT) is working and whether the treatment is providing the desired benefits, such as symptom relief and improved well-being.
Bioidentical hormone replacement therapy (BHRT) doctors require extensive testing, including urine testing, to assess the hormonal status of their patients and determine the most appropriate course of treatment.
